Tourism Development Company of Trinidad & Tobago Taps New Interim President

“Ernest Littles, president of the Tourism Development Company of Trinidad & Tobago, tendered his resignation today,” announced George Stanley Beard, chairman, on Friday.  “We deeply appreciate his years of dedication to forwarding the mission of tourism and hospitality for Trinidad & Tobago and we are grateful for his many substantial achievements.”

Lara M. de Sonpere, Divisional Manager, Legal and Administrative, and Corporate Secretary to the Board of Directors of the Tourism Development Company, has been named Interim President.

“The TDC is reviewing its structure to ensure alignment with its mandate and this is expected to be completed within the next two months and in the meantime, Ms. de Sonpere will ensure the entire Trinidad & Tobago team of the TDC as well as the overseas representatives will go forward with their strategic plans,” continued Chairman Beard.

The overseas representatives from the United States, Europe and the United Kingdom have an extremely strong line up of foreign media, including the BBC and CNN, due to arrive in Trinidad & Tobago for Carnival 2011 next week which is sure to capture the world’s attention. 

The entire Board of Directors of the TDC is enthusiastic about the potential of increasing both awareness and tourism arrivals for the coming year.  Further, strategic initiatives in the UK, Europe and North America are planned and will be announced in the next month.
